Podcast with hip hop group, alt rockers

Jeff of Heavyweight Dub Champion

French

The most intriguing podcast interview I conducted at the South by Southwest Music Festival last week came with the members of Heavyweight Dub Champion, a hip-hop/reggae/Caribbean sounds group out of Colorado, of all places. Spoke with Jeff (pictured at top), Stero, Totter, Grant and Patch in the podcast, featuring two of the group's singles. They say they have three records coming out this year.

I also interviewed the members of pouty girl rockers Magneta Lane (with bass player French pictured above) for this podcast (mp3 file | TowerPod page). Chris Ritke of 49media produced the podcast.
